I just followed up on a baby who is now 7 wk.  He was observed by the LC at
hospital and me to have a tongue tie.  Mom was experiencing soreness, but
her pediatrician felt it was not a concern.  So it was not clipped.
    I called today to see if the soreness caused her to stop bf.  She is
still bf, and the soreness only lasted a few weeks.  However, he is still
nursing q 2.5 hr, even at night.  We discussed some strategies to get him
to go a longer stretch at night.
   My afterthought:  Could it be that he is not able to remove milk very
efficiently, so quits eating, or his suck is not sufficiently strong so
that it does not cause her to incr supply?  This is a gravida 3, nursed 2
girls for at least 4 mo before him.  Wt gain is adequate per mom, though he
has not been weighed since 2 wk old.
  Wise sisters, is there something more to this?  I'll call back in 2 wk to
check of 2 mo exam since he is not our pt here at our practice.
